软考中级网络工程师之交换机与路由器的配置(三)
生成树协议配置
生成树协议(STP)的目的是在实现交换机之间冗余连接的同时,避免网络环路的出现,实现网络的高可靠性。当交换机之间有多个VLAN时Trunk线路负载会过重,这时需要设置多个Trunk端口,但这样会形成网络环路,而STP协议便可以解决这一问题。
1. 使用STP端口权值实现负载均衡
假如用端口f0/23做Trunk1,用端口f0/24做Trunk2,则配置如下。
(配置VTP)
Switch1#vlan dataBase (进入VLAN配置子模式)
Switch1(vlan)#vtp server (设置本交换机为Server模式)
Switch1(vlan)#vtp domain vtpserver (设置域名)
Switch1(vlan)#exit
Switch1#show vtp status (验证VTP设置信息)
(配置Trunk)
Switch1#config terminal
Switch1(config)#interface f0/23 (进入端口23配置模式)
Switch1(config-if)#switchport mode trunk (设置当前端口为Trunk模式)
Switch1(config-if)#exit
Switch1(config)#interface f0/24 (进入端口24配置模式)
Switch1(config-if)#switchport mode trunk (设置当前端口为Trunk模式)
Switch1(config-if)#end
Switch1#
(配置STP权值)
Switch1#config terminal
Switch1(config)# interface f0/23 (进入端口23配置模式,Trunk1)
Switch1(config-if)#spanning-tree vlan 1 port-priority 10 (将VLAN 1的端口权值设为10)
Switch1(config-if)#spanning-tree vlan 2 port-priority 10 (将VLAN 2的端口权值设为10)
Switch1(config-if)#exit
Switch1(config)#interface f0/24 (进入端口24配置模式,Trunk2)
Switch1(config-if)#spanning-tree vlan 3 port-priority 10 (将VLAN 3的端口权值设为10)
Switch1(config-if)#spanning-tree vlan 4 port-priority 10 (将VLAN 4的端口权值设为10)
Switch1(config-if)#spanning-tree vlan 5 port-priority 10 (将VLAN 5的端口权值设为10)
Switch1(config-if)#end
Switch1#copy running-config startup-config (保存配置文件)
2. 配置STP路径值的负载均衡
Switch1#config terminal
Switch1(config)#interface f0/23 (进入端口23配置模式,Trunk1)
Switch1(config-if)#spanning-tree vlan 3 cost 30 (设置VLAN 3生成树路径值为30)
Switch1(config-if)#spanning-tree vlan 4 cost 30 (设置VLAN 4生成树路径值为30)
Switch1(config-if)#spanning-tree vlan 5 cost 30 (设置VLAN 5生成树路径值为30)
Switch1(config-if)#exit
Switch1(config)#interface f0/24 (进入端口24配置模式,配置Trunk2)
Switch1(config-if)#spanning-tree vlan 1 cost 30 (设置VLAN 1生成树路径值为30)
Switch1(config-if)#spanning-tree vlan 2 cost 30 (设置VLAN 2生成树路径值为30)
Switch1(config-if)#end
Switch1#
经过学习与实践经验的融合,我们的首要使命是为每位考生注入强大的动力,帮助他们铸就坚实的网络工程知识体系。这一步伐至关重要,它将使你在紧锣密鼓的软件资格考试备战中,无论遭遇何种难题,都能自信满满、游刃有余。